American Battery Metals Corporation (OTCMKTS: ABML) has announced Ryan Melsert’s appointment as the new Chief Executive officer of the company.

Ryan Melsert appointed CEO

Advertisement

The appointment of Melsert, who was the Chief Technology Officer, is part of the company’s leadership transformation to prioritize its tech development and transformation initiatives and position American Battery metals for growth.

Outgoing CEO Doug Cole said, “Ryan and I have been working together closely over the past two years to set the direction of this company and to help evolve it to where it is today. Over the past few months Ryan has increasingly taken over day-to-day leadership responsibilities including setting long-term company strategies, leading investor presentations, developing high-value strategic partnerships, and leading the recruiting and hiring of company executives. It is in the best interests of the company to formalize this leadership transition and to appoint him as company CEO, and I look forward to supporting this succession in every way needed going forward.”

American battery Metals reprioritizes resources to in-house tech development

Meslert commented, “It has been a privilege to work alongside Doug, our independent board members, employees, and other key stakeholders over the past two years to build this strong foundation upon which we will further accelerate our growth. We have an unprecedented set of tailwinds behind us as our technologies simultaneously address the critical needs of mitigating global climate change and the environmental impact of conventional battery metals mining, of producing lower cost battery metals to increase the penetration of electric storage solutions throughout the market, and of increasing domestic production of battery metals to improve security of supply and national security interests.”

In addition, Meslert said that the company is committed to solving challenges within the primary battery metals and lithium-ion battery recycling fields. Therefore, the board will convene a shareholder meeting to nominate directors to support the growth strategy and commercialization.
